Historic Homes Tour
Various locations across the park
Step back in time exploring the diverse homes, from frontier cabins to grander residences, showcasing family history.

Cowboy Demonstrations
Ranch area
Witness impressive teamwork as cowboys and their dogs guide longhorns, a truly authentic Texan experience.

Blacksmith Shop
Blacksmith area
Fascinating explanations and live demonstrations of traditional blacksmithing crafts.

Living History Actors
Throughout the park
Engaging actors bring different eras to life, offering insights into daily life and historical events.

🚇 🗺️ Getting There
George Ranch Historical Park is located in Richmond, Texas, southwest of Houston. It's accessible by car, with ample parking available. Many visitors use GPS navigation to find the park.
Public transportation options directly to the park are limited. It's generally recommended to drive or use ride-sharing services for the most convenient access.
The travel time from downtown Houston to George Ranch Historical Park can vary depending on traffic, but it typically takes around 45 minutes to an hour.
While George Ranch itself offers a historical experience, for nature-focused day trips nearby, consider Brazos Bend State Park for hiking and wildlife viewing.
From Houston, take US-59 South to TX-99 South. Exit onto TX-36 South towards Richmond. Turn right onto FM 1093 West, and the park entrance will be on your left. Always check a GPS for real-time routes.

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ience
You can explore historic homes, witness cowboy demonstrations, visit the blacksmith shop, interact with living history actors, and enjoy special events.
Yes, kids often enjoy the hands-on activities, animal encounters, and the engaging historical reenactments. However, some find it less ideal for very young children due to the amount of walking.
Most visitors spend around 3 to 4 hours exploring the park and enjoying the demonstrations. You might want to allocate more time if attending a special event.
The park offers tours of its historic homes led by knowledgeable volunteers who provide excellent historical context.
Generally, pets are not allowed inside the park, except for service animals. It's always best to confirm the park's specific pet policy before your visit.
